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65466 653857 541334902 7633
62254367 036 70
62254367 036 70
3060756184 6612136 079 54655
All about undefined
Interested in learning more?
62254367 036 70
3060756184 6612136 079 54655
See more
3529125371 0719
8734907798 4248 802168
See more
44235947571 59964340
58 9040 81214969361
See more